Liturgy/sacraments
"Grandma's Bread" remains a favorite video for many and needs to be included in this listing. This 17-minute video tells a story of family, tradition, cultural awareness and Eucharist. It is available in Spanish and English ($29.95 and $39.95) from SAM/FC, and it is highly regarded.
"This Is the Night,' produced by Liturgy Training Publications (1-800-933-1800, $39.95) received frequent mention. This 30-minute video probes the rites and symbols of the Easter Vigil. Though a bit dated, it nonetheless is a powerful testimony to the central role of the catechumenate in the faith journey of a parish community.
Another favorite is "Called by Name," a baptism video that weaves four stories around the theme of death and resurrection. No longer available on its own, it has been incorporated into SAM/FC's new adult education "Catholic Update" video series and is contained in "Adult Baptism: Exploring Its Meaning" ($39.95).
Richard Fragomeni's "Liturgical Catechesis for Children" is a helpful set of audiocassettes for those who work with children's liturgy and is currently available for $16.50 from SAM/FC.
National Pastoral Musician audiotapes from NPM conferences were mentioned by several people as wonderful resources for continuing education. The problem is that NPM sells only tapes from their most recent meetings. Tapes from the July 1995 meeting may be purchased by calling (202) 723-5800. The cost is $7.50.
Similarly, Walter Burkhardt's recommended 1991 preaching tape is not available. However, Liturgy Training Publications is marketing a new five-video series, "Preaching the Just Word." Walter Burkhardt is a member of the retreat team and appears in the first video, "An Overview of the Retreat" and is featured in the fifth, "Preparing the Homily" ($29.95).
Kathleen Chesto comes highly recommended by many. In particular, her video, "Family Spirituality," was frequently mentioned. Available from Twenty-third Publications (1-800-321-0411 $39.95), this 25-minute video is a source of affirmation and enrichment as it identifies holiness in the reality of family life. Chesto's "Sacrament of Reconciliation - Past and Present" is another often-mentioned video.
"Pardon and Peace: Sacrament of Reconciliation" ($39.95) is an 11-minute video about a runaway who experiences alienation and reconciliation. "Living Eucharist" ($19.95) is a 10-minute video that uses everyday stories to connect Eucharist to the community's lived experience. Both videos are available in Spanish and English from SAM/FC.
Individual spirituality
Of all the people I contracted, two stand out as being firmly committed to using audio/video resources for their own development. One said, "I buy something every year for my own development. I set aside money that I have earned playing for weddings and use that because I have decided that what I buy will improve my ministry. This year I have just ordered Megan McKenna's `The People of Advent' (Credence Cassettes, 1-800-333-7373, $23.95, three-cassette set). I like anything Megan McKenna does and highly recommend her cassette tapes."
